I have visited Disney many times during this period and the weather is very unpredictable, anywhere from low 50s to low 80s during the day.

Ive heard that Stormalong Bay is a heated pool, but given its enormous size I cant believe that the water really is warm enough to swim in even if we are lucky enough to get temps in the 70s during the day. Has anyone stayed at YC/BC during these times and did you swim at SAB??

The quiet pools tend to be warmer than the main pool. The hot tubs, of course are really warm. If the air temp isn't too bad, you should get some swimming in.
